Happy 50th birthday to the absolute Canucks legend Gino Odjick! Let’s revisit the iconic story of Gino knocking on the door of the KGB Headquarters and demanding they take him to Pavel Bure 😂
Drance: Do you have a great Gino story that you particularly hold dear?
Bure: Well, my best Gino story is when he came to Russia. He came to Moscow and wanted to surprise me, but nobody met him at the airport. So he grabbed a cab and he went to KGB building. So he started knocking on the door of the KGB building, saying, “I’m Gino Odjick, I’m here to see Pavel!” One hour later they brought him to me. That was pretty funny.
Odjick: I didn’t realize how big Moscow was. I think there’s 12-13 million people. So I ask a cab driver, “Do you know where Pavel Bure lives?” He’s like “… no?” But I knew from Pavel telling me that the KGB they always know what’s going on. So I told the cab driver, bring me to the KGB office. He’s like “no, no, no, you don’t want to go there!” I said, “Bring me to the KGB office!” So I knock on the door and they open the door and they have a machine gun stuck in my face, they’re like “What do you want!?” I’m like “I’m looking for Pavel Bure, we’re playing a charity game against the Red Army!” I told them the story about Fetisov not sending anybody to pick me up. Within 15 minutes they send me to the hotel where everybody was and I meet up with Pavel.
